Densitylb/cu in. at 68°F | 0.304 |
---|---|
Specific Gravity | 8.41 |
Electrical Conductivity% IACS at 68°F | 6 |
Modulus of Elasticity in Tensionksi | 16200 |
Technique | Suitability |
---|---|
Soldering | Excellent |
Brazing | Excellent |
Oxyacetylene Welding | Fair |
Gas Shielded Arc Welding | Fair |
Coated Metal Arc Welding | Fair |
Spot Weld | Excellent |
Seam Weld | Excellent |
Butt Weld | Good |
Capacity for Being Cold Worked | Good |
Capacity for Being Hot Formed | Good |
